Hi. I have a computer that belongs to my friend. For a reason unknown to me, it will start botting up and then change to the "blue screen of death:mad:" aroudn the time the login screen should show up. I told my firend I would re-install Vista from a flash drive I had. I cannot seem to be able to access the file from the boot menu or anything else. Tips please? All is appreciated.

Hi kouu tori,

We can try few troubleshooting steps. Try to go in safe mode and check if you are able to login in safe mode.

If yes, please if you can get us the mini-dump information; Please use the following link for detailed instructions: http://www.vistax64.com/crashes-debugging/282419-blue-screen-death-bsod-posting-instructions.html

If no, run the built-in diagnostics provided by the manufacturer on the computer to check if the hardware is working fine.

Please post back with the results.

I don't have a toshiba - think it may be F12 at post to get the boot menu selection.

You need to plug the flash in, start the machine, keep tapping F12 tiil the boot selection menu appears.

I expect it supports booting from usb.
